🙂A single person spends $1,181 per month in Yamaguchi vs $1,279 in Tbilisi,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$1,829 per month in Yamaguchi vs $2,011 in Tbilisi,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$2,478 per month in Yamaguchi vs $2,743 in Tbilisi, rent included.
🙂Yamaguchi is about 8% cheaper than Tbilisi,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both Yamaguchi and Tbilisi are more affordable than the global median – Yamaguchi14% lower, Tbilisi7% lower.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$429 in Yamaguchi versus $681 in Tbilisi.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$33.00 in Yamaguchi versus $38.00 in Tbilisi. Groceries tell a different story – $324 in Yamaguchi vs $236 in Tbilisi – so Tbilisi wins on supermarket bills even if dining out costs more.
